Christian Moore
I use FL studio. My subs are from the 2013 808 Mafia pack. I cut out frequencies lower than 30 and higher than 230. Take the stock FL Fast Dist and set it to overdrive. You're gonna want to turn that effect down to about 25% on the mix though. I'm still pretty new to the whole production world.
